Claimed vs real mileage

Expect 57–63 kmpl from the Super Splendor Xtec in everyday use against a claimed mileage of 69 kmpl. The 13% gap is about average for the class.

Among the 21 commuter bikes we have reviewed it ranks 9th for mileage, 4 kmpl above the group average of 65 kmpl.

At Delhi's petrol price of ₹94.80 a litre and a real-world 60 kmpl, the Super Splendor Xtec costs about ₹1.58 per km in fuel. Ride 30 km a day and that is roughly ₹1,232 a month, or ₹14,789 a year, before servicing.

The 12-litre tank gives a realistic range of about 720 km, so a 30 km commute means a fill-up every 3 weeks.

Five-year cost of ownership

Base variant bought in Delhi, 30 km a day. Servicing and insurance renewals are typical figures for the class.

On-road purchase
₹97,100
Fuel
₹73,945
Servicing
₹17,500
Insurance renewals
₹4,660
Five-year total
₹1,93,205

Spread over five years and 46,800 km, the Super Splendor Xtec works out to about ₹4.1 per km all-in, of which 38% is fuel and 50% is the purchase price itself. Resale value is not counted; expect roughly 50–60% of ex-showroom after five years for a well-kept example.

Getting the best mileage

The quickest wins for the Super Splendor Xtec: keep tyres at the recommended pressure (under-inflation by 5 psi can cost 2–3 kmpl), shift up early and avoid idling at long signals, which the idle start-stop system handles for you.

Short trips hurt most. A cold engine on a 2 km run can return half its normal mileage; if that is your use, expect the low end of the real-world band.

Service on time. A clogged air filter or old spark plug shows up in mileage before it shows up anywhere else.

Super Splendor Xtec mileage: questions people ask

What is the mileage of the Super Splendor Xtec?
Claimed mileage is 69 kmpl. Owners typically see 57–63 kmpl in mixed city and highway riding.
How much does the Super Splendor Xtec cost to run per month?
Fuel works out to about ₹1.58 per km in Delhi, so a 30 km daily commute costs roughly ₹1,232 a month before servicing.
